Transaction 18a8c759908801519831c5e57a057ed7af90f2433a6670788ec34f9f459b64fe
1 Input
1 Output
-
18a8c759908801519831c5e57a057ed7af90f2433a6670788ec34f9f459b64fe:0
- value
- 2348
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 231686b1b5f5ff4a217de007157e2b231b4d145f OP_EQUAL
- address
- 34tYZQGvGB83c7Wp9JhPG4VJfgvTTZ7ngu